Saint Henry’s housing market presents a distinct opportunity. We often see a mix of well-maintained family homes, newer constructions on the outskirts, and attractive rural properties. This variety means your financing needs can be specific. A local lender who regularly works in Mercer County will have a keen sense of property values in our neighborhoods, from the village center to the surrounding township. They understand how factors like acreage, outbuildings, or proximity to local schools can impact an appraisal, which is crucial for a smooth loan process.
When starting your search, think beyond just interest rates. Look for lenders with deep roots in West Central Ohio. Local credit unions, like those in Celina or Coldwater, and community banks often have a strong presence and may offer more personalized service and flexibility. They know the local economy, which is anchored by agriculture, manufacturing, and small businesses. This insight can be invaluable, especially if you’re self-employed or have a non-traditional income structure common in our area.
Ohio also offers several programs that a knowledgeable local lender can help you unlock. The Ohio Housing Finance Agency (OHFA) provides first-time homebuyer programs with competitive interest rates, down payment assistance, and tax credits. "First-time" is broadly defined by OHFA, so even if you haven't owned a home in three years, you might qualify. A lender familiar with these programs can be the key to accessing this crucial help, making homeownership more affordable as you look at Saint Henry's available listings.
